The Tabler user pentagon icon depicts a stylized user silhouette within a pentagonal shape, often used to represent user-centric systems or structured user data.
Common uses
- User profile management sections
- System settings related to users
- Data visualization of user groups
Use it in React
Install
npm i @tabler/icons-reactImport & render
import { IconUserPentagon } from '@tabler/icons-react';
<IconUserPentagon size={24} stroke={2} />Details
